Sato, a global player in barcode printing, labelling and auto-ID, has launched the CT4-LX-HC, a dedicated 4in (10.16cm) label printer for the healthcare sector.

As healthcare services increasingly adopt digitisation, accurate and user-friendly options are key to keeping patient care the top priority. Such products must also deliver and be future-proof, to help medical facilities meet the needs of a growing and ageing population.

The CT4-LX-HC is described as a ‘versatile’ desktop printer. It features an antimicrobial casing that can be wiped down with disinfectant wipes, to minimise the risk of infections and recontamination in a clinical setting. It expedites patient workflows for accurate pharmacy labelling with its one-touch media profile recall function and print speeds of up to 8in/s. The onboard intelligence from Sato AEP (application-enabled printing), which autonomously verifies labels against the printer’s database before printing, ensures accurate end results.

Creating a user-friendly printer was noted as a top priority for Sato. The 4.3in colour touchscreen is a good example, as well as coming with onboard guidance videos as standard, which are easily accessible. Multiple interfaces allow connection to wide ranging devices. The CT4-LX-HC can print PDF data generated via other systems directly, reducing errors, time and resources with PDF Direct Printing.
